Wake Forest Tennis Achieving New Heights

We bring back our coverage of the Wake Forest tennis team who are even better than ever.

Generally when a team loses the best player in program history, they experience a precipitous drop the following season. This is not the case for the 2016 Wake Forest men's tennis team.

After winning ACC Player of the Year and reaching the NCAA Singles Championship in his freshman year, Noah Rubin left Winston-Salem for a full-time career on the pro tour. But his one year paved the way for top players to follow in his footsteps. His impact on the racquetmen is commensurate to the impact of Harry Giles joining Wake on the hardwood.
